// Scope: read-only memory snapshots from the Embergrid fleet.
// The client streams allocation traces to the Tallowmark collector;
// no kernel payloads leave the host, only sizes and timestamps.
// Security notes: TLS pinned to the internal Tallowmark CA,
// traces scrubbed of tensor names before upload, retention 14 days.
// Credential is fleet-scoped, not per-node; rotate quarterly via
// the Hollowbine console. Reviewer: confirm scope matches policy.
// The client authenticates to Tallowmark with the key below.

app token of badug-tahaf = qvz11-nP5FBNr8qnh

Welcome to the Ledgerpane team. If the audit-log viewer's CI suite fails on the pagination snapshot tests, first check whether the seeded fixture clock drifted — the generator pins timestamps, and any change to the seed file invalidates every snapshot. Regenerate snapshots locally, review the diff carefully, then re-run. When you open a ticket, always include the build token printed at the end of the failing job, copied below.

session token of tajef-bageg = htk21_5d90d574934f3ccae6437

## Onboarding: Shipping the Widedelta Diff Viewer

Quick context for the eng sync: Widedelta is our diff viewer tuned for huge files — think multi-gigabyte logs that choke normal tools. It streams chunks instead of loading everything, which is why releases are a bit fussy. Every build artifact must be signed before the updater will accept it, and unsigned builds silently fall back to the old version (fun to debug, ask Priya-from-platform). To get your local toolchain verifying builds, you'll need the team signing key.

deploy key for kajof-fajop: bky6_gDHw9Q